The following discussion points: 1) It is been said that the highest priority differences between I2RS and NETCONF are the following things: a) Quick Feedback loop for applications, b) Being able to tie ephemeral to config What do you think? 2) How much feedback do you want in your applications? 3) Should I2RS allow data transfer on an insecure protocol? a) If so, what restrictions should be placed on the data models allowing data transfer? b) Should the data transfer over insecure protocol be limited to just publication or subscription data? 4) What data should the ephemeral data models be able to refer to in order to do constraint checking? The options are: a) ephemeral to configuration state, b) ephemeral to operational state (for example, an LSP-ID for an LSP that is created) c) ephemeral configuration to ephemeral configuration Examples could be; a) I2RS RIB model referring to the I2RS topology model b) I2RS BGP model referring to I2RS RIB d) ephemeral configuration to ephemeral "protocol" state I2RS RIB route configuration referencing I2RS Topology model to check the summary of learned logical paths 5) Do you think the protocol security requirement are adequate for the protocol? 6) Have we missed anything in the requirements? What are your 3 top priority requirements?
